Recent Developments in Trademark Law in Africa

Mark Robbins and Susan Anthony

Susan Anthony, a US Patent Trademark Office attorney advisor, presented on trademark law in Africa during the ABA International Trademark Laws Committee meeting. She highlighted the territorial nature of trademarks, the complexities of international trademark strategy, and the differences in application searches, processes, fees, and examinations among various trademark offices. She also discussed defensive registration, the increasing adoption of the Madrid Protocol by African countries, the importance of post-registration filings and license recordals, and the topic of geographical indications. She emphasized the need for collaboration and cooperation in her work.
